Core i7 "Haswell-E" Engineering Sample Pictured

Here's the first picture of Intel's next-generation Core i7 HEDT (high-end desktop) processor, codenamed "Haswell-E." Based on Intel's latest "Haswell" micro-architecture, the chip will be Intel's first HEDT processor to ship with eight cores, and the first client CPU to ship with next-generation DDR4 memory interface. In addition to IPC improvements over "Ivy Bridge" that come with "Haswell," the chip integrates a quad-channel DDR4 integrated memory controller, with native memory speeds of DDR4-2133 MHz; a PCI-Express gen 3.0 root complex with a total of 40 PCI-Express lanes, and yet the same DMI 2.0 (4 GB/s) chipset bus.

Built into the LGA2011-3 socket, "Haswell-E" will be incompatible with current LGA2011 motherboards, as the notches of the package will vary from LGA2011 "Ivy Bridge-E." Intel will introduce the new X99 Express chipset, featuring all 6 Gb/s SATA ports, integrated USB 3.0 controllers, and a PCI-Express gen 2.0 root complex for third-party onboard controllers. Interestingly, there's no mention of SATA-Express, which Intel's next-generation 9-series chipset for Core "Broadwell" platforms reportedly ships with; and X99 isn't looking too different from today's Z87 chipset. With engineering samples already out, it wouldn't surprise us if Intel launches "Haswell-E" along the sidelines of any of next year's big-three trade-shows (CES, CeBIT, and Computex).
